COVID Relief Fund Created

by Goleta Education Foundation

The Goleta Education Foundation (GEF) is committed to supporting Goleta elementary schools through the COVID-19 pandemic. The COVID Relief Fund is designed to help the Goleta Union School District (GUSD) financially during this challenging time to ensure the safety of students, teachers, and staff in order to promote the best learning opportunities for all students… Read More

STEAM at Home: S’mores in the Sun

by Goleta Education Foundation

Everyone knows s’mores over the fire, but have you heard of s’mores cooked by the sun? This at home STEAM lesson was featured by Mountain View School’s STEAM teacher, Blair Butler, as a fun (and delicious) activity to do at home. STEAM at Home: Polka Dots Make Art!

by Goleta Education Foundation

Anyone can make art and anything can make art. Kellogg School’s Art teacher Jessica Zavala featured a lesson on Yayoi Kusama, a Japanese contemporary artist, as part of her virtual learning experience in the spring.
